Purchase the full SWOT analysis to access a professionally written, editable report with financial context, strategic recommendations, and an Excel model to support investment, planning, or pitch decks.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ter green\"\u003eS\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003etrengths\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per green\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Strengths-Lightning-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eDominant Niche Market Leadership\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ld holds clear leadership as the primary online travel agent for hostels, reaching ~4.5m annual bookers in 2024 and a 60%+ market share in dedicated hostel bookings, giving it a focused brand general platforms lack. By serving budget social travelers—mostly 18–34-year-olds—it built a loyal community that values shared experiences over luxury. Its niche lets it offer hostel-specific filters, verified social features, and property details that general OTAs do not.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Strengths-Lightning-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eAdvanced Social Features and Network Effects\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e Solo System and in-app social tools have turned Hostelworld into a community hub, not just a booking engine; monthly active users reached ~1.8M in 2025, driving session times 30% above OTA averages.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003ePre-arrival connections boost engagement and retention—bookers who use social features show a 22% higher repeat-booking rate and 18% higher ARPU versus non-users.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Those interactions create network effects: as the user base grows, listings see 12% higher occupancy on average, increasing platform value for travelers and hosts.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Strengths-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Strengths-Lightning-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eHigh Margin Asset-Light Business Model\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ld operates as a pure-play marketplace, earning commission-based revenue that delivered a 2024 adjusted EBITDA margin of about 27% (full-year 2024 reported), reflecting its high-margin, asset-light model.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Not owning properties lets Hostelworld scale rapidly across 179 markets (2024 end) without real estate capex, cutting fixed costs and boosting return on invested capital.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e asset-light setup keeps the company agile, enabling faster pivots in distribution, pricing and product features to match shifting traveler preferences and seasonal demand.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-green-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Strengths-Lightning-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eExtensive Global Inventory and Partnerships\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-green-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ld lists over 17,000 properties in 170+ countries, a scale hard for new entrants to match and key for multi-destination budget travel.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eLong-term ties with property managers secure priority availability and often exclusive rates in top markets like Barcelona, Bangkok, and Lisbon, improving conversion and yield.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e broad inventory and supplier depth position Hostelworld as a one-stop shop for budget travelers, supporting cross-sell and higher repeat bookings.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e17,000+ properties; EBITDA (2024)\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003e~27%\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eAvg. occupancy (key markets)\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003e\u0026gt;60%\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003c\/tbody\u003e\n\u003c\/table\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-includes\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eWhat is included in the product\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Word-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Word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eDetailed Word Document\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eDelivers a concise SWOT overview of Hostelworld, outlining its market strengths, operational weaknesses, growth opportunities in global budget travel, and external threats from competitors and changing travel dynamics.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"plus-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Plus-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Plus Icon\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Excel-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Excel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eCustomizable Excel Spreadsheet\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eProvides a concise SWOT matrix tailored to Hostelworld for fast, visual strategy alignment and quick stakeholder briefings.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ter orange\"\u003eW\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003eeaknesses\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per orange\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eHeavy Reliance on Youth Travel Demographic\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e company derives roughly 70% of bookings from the 18–35 demographic, leaving it exposed if youth spending falls; Eurostat reported youth unemployment in the EU averaging 14% in 2024, and UK youth unemployment hit 11% in late 2024, which can cut discretionary travel demand. During 2023–2024 economic softness, Hostelworld’s revenue per available bednight fell about 8% year-over-year in some European markets, showing sensitivity to youth income swings. This narrow focus also limits capture of higher-yield travelers: global adults 35+ account for over 60% of international tourism spend per UNWTO 2023, a segment Hostelworld underindexes against.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eSignificant Marketing Spend Requirements\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ld must sustain heavy performance-marketing spend to match Expedia Group and Google; in 2024 it spent roughly 24% of revenue on sales \u0026amp; marketing (H1 2024 S\u0026amp;M margin ~23–25%), with a large share going to Google Ads and Meta. Redirecting this revenue into paid acquisition compresses EBITDA (2023 adjusted EBITDA margin ~4–6%), and algorithm shifts or CPC increases quickly raise customer acquisition costs and pressure margins.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eGeographic Concentration in Europe\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ld remains Europe-heavy: in FY2024 about 68% of bookings and 71% of available beds were in Europe, concentrating revenue and inventory in the Eurozone.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is geographic imbalance raises exposure to regional GDP swings, Eurozone travel slowdowns, and EU regulatory changes that could cut RevPAR or booking volumes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eExpansion into Asia and LATAM improved—Asia bookings rose 18% YoY in 2024—but Europe still drives roughly 70% of group revenue, keeping geographic risk elevated.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eLimited Control Over Property Quality\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eAs an intermediary, Hostelworld (HQ Dublin) cannot directly control hostel quality or safety; in 2024 complaints citing cleanliness\/safety made up ~14% of platform reviews, which can damage brand trust despite non-management of properties.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Negative incidents at a single hostel can lower overall NPS; Hostelworld reported an overall review-average of 4.1\/5 in 2024, but top complaints cluster at a minority of listings, showing inconsistent standards across independent operators.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eMaintaining uniform quality across ~17,000 listings worldwide (2024) remains a persistent reputation risk and a challenge for platform-wide quality assurance.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e~17,000 listings (2024)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eAverage rating 4.1\/5 (2024)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e~14% reviews cite cleanliness\/safety\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eLimited direct operational control\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eVulnerability to Commission Rate Pressure\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ld relies mainly on commission fees from hostels; in FY2024 commissions made about 68% of revenue, leaving the company exposed if rates fall.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eLarger chains can negotiate discounts, and direct-booking tools (e.g., channel managers) grew 24% YoY in 2024, risking lower take-rates.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eIf hostels shift to cheaper direct channels, Hostelworld’s commission margins—reported at 45% gross margin in 2024—could compress.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e68% revenue from commissions (FY2024)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e45% gross margin (2024)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e24% YoY growth in channel-manager\/direct bookings (2024)\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/SWOT-Content-Weaknesses-Cloud-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eYouth‑centric, Europe‑heavy Hostelworld faces commission, marketing and quality risks\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Hostelworld is youth-skewed (≈70% bookings 18–35), Europe-concentrated (≈68% bookings, 71% beds FY2024), and reliant on commissions (68% revenue, 45% gross margin FY2024), raising sensitivity to youth unemployment (EU youth jobless 14% 2024), regional GDP swings, paid-marketing cost pressure (S\u0026amp;M ≈24% revenue H1 2024), and inconsistent quality across ~17,000 listings (avg rating 4.1\/5;
